WitrynaHowever, the high yields of most root crops ensure an energy output per hectare per day which is considerably higher than that of grains (see Table 4.1). Sweet potato for example has a tremendous capacity for producing high yields, up to 85 t/ha have been recorded on experimental plots, though most plantation yields do not exceed 20 t/ha. WitrynaSweet potato is an important root crop in tropical and sub tropical countries like China, USA, India, Japan, Indonesia, Philippines, Thailand, Vietnam, Nigeria etc. Among the root and tuber crops grown in the world, sweet potato ranks second after cassava (Ray and Ravi 2005). Sweet potatoes are … colwich elementary school colwich ksWitryna30 cze 2024 · Most varieties take 90–110 days from planting out to reach a good size, if the weather is warm enough. The first month or so after transplanting is the root development stage. Roots can go 8’ (2.4 m) deep in 40 days. Don’t be alarmed at the lack of above-ground action.
